Output 8e933f32ac3efef6b30a4023a0168984d6f89285785218f2cdeddf6019448322:23

value
124084409
script pubkey
OP_0 OP_PUSHBYTES_32 4e2a66f185188c707dad0c5734fb45b595562d4c8d50218353a63514a7353744
address
bc1qfc4xduv9rzx8qlddp3tnf769kk24vt2v34gzrq6n5c63ffe4xazq2glzuy
transaction
8e933f32ac3efef6b30a4023a0168984d6f89285785218f2cdeddf6019448322
spent
true